Hi,
ich habe hier ein Plugin (ist generiert, kommt von EMF/GMF ist aber wohl auch egal), und es funktioniert in einer Eclipse Test Applikation (Run As -> Eclipse App). D.h. ich sehe dort im "New"-Wizard auch mein Plugin von dem ich eine Instanz erzeugen kann, genauso wie es in den Extension der plugin.xml angezeigt ist. (Dort wird das in den "Examples" Ornder des New-Wizards gesteckt)
So, nun kriege ich es aber nicht hin das Ding zu exportieren. Ich mache:
File -> Export... -> Plug-in Development -> Deployable plug-ins and fragment
und wähle das gesamte Projekt aus, in dem die plugins-xml steckt.
Das generiert mir auch ohne Fehlermeldungen einen plugins-Ordner mit einem JAR drinnen. Aber wenn ich nun Eclipse schließe, diese JAR in meinen Eclipse Plugin-Ordner ziehe, und Eclipse neustarte, ist davon keine Spur. Es wird auch nicht angezeigt in den Plugins (Help -> About Eclipse -> Plugins).
Hat jmd eine Idee wieso das in der Test-App funzt und dann aber in der "echten" nicht mehr? Exportier ich das falsch oder wieso erkennt er das nicht?
Vielen Dank... lg
edit: Hier mal ein Ausschnitt aus der plugins.xml, der zeigt dass bei den Extensions eig. im File->New Wizard mein Plugin angezeigt werden müsste. (Was es in der Testumgebund ja wie gesagt auch tut)
ich habe hier ein Plugin (ist generiert, kommt von EMF/GMF ist aber wohl auch egal), und es funktioniert in einer Eclipse Test Applikation (Run As -> Eclipse App). D.h. ich sehe dort im "New"-Wizard auch mein Plugin von dem ich eine Instanz erzeugen kann, genauso wie es in den Extension der plugin.xml angezeigt ist. (Dort wird das in den "Examples" Ornder des New-Wizards gesteckt)
So, nun kriege ich es aber nicht hin das Ding zu exportieren. Ich mache:
File -> Export... -> Plug-in Development -> Deployable plug-ins and fragment
und wähle das gesamte Projekt aus, in dem die plugins-xml steckt.
Das generiert mir auch ohne Fehlermeldungen einen plugins-Ordner mit einem JAR drinnen. Aber wenn ich nun Eclipse schließe, diese JAR in meinen Eclipse Plugin-Ordner ziehe, und Eclipse neustarte, ist davon keine Spur. Es wird auch nicht angezeigt in den Plugins (Help -> About Eclipse -> Plugins).
Hat jmd eine Idee wieso das in der Test-App funzt und dann aber in der "echten" nicht mehr? Exportier ich das falsch oder wieso erkennt er das nicht?
Vielen Dank... lg
edit: Hier mal ein Ausschnitt aus der plugins.xml, der zeigt dass bei den Extensions eig. im File->New Wizard mein Plugin angezeigt werden müsste. (Was es in der Testumgebund ja wie gesagt auch tut)

Zuletzt bearbeitet: